Oil Prices Surge 6% as Trump Signals Prolonged Iran Conflict
Oil prices surged in early Asian trade on Thursday after President Trump signaled that Washington would continue its military campaign against Iran, including potential strikes on energy infrastructure. Before the speech, prices had dropped on expectations of de-escalation, leading to a sharp spike when Trump made it clear the war would continue.
